所选语种没有对应资源,请选择:

本站点使用Cookies,继续浏览表示您同意我们使用Cookies。Cookies和隐私政策>

提示

尊敬的用户,您的IE浏览器版本过低,为获取更好的浏览体验,请升级您的IE浏览器。

升级

CloudEngine 12800, 12800E V200R005C10 RESTful API参考

本文档介绍了设备支持的OPS API,内容包含OPS 支持的操作、请求示例、请求中元素说明、响应示例、响应中元素说明和响应状态码说明。
评分并提供意见反馈 :
华为采用机器翻译与人工审校相结合的方式将此文档翻译成不同语言,希望能帮助您更容易理解此文档的内容。 请注意:即使是最好的机器翻译,其准确度也不及专业翻译人员的水平。 华为对于翻译的准确性不承担任何责任,并建议您参考英文文档(已提供链接)。
文件系统

文件系统

显示工作目录

操作

URI

描述

GET

/vfm/pwds/pwd

获取当前工作目录。

  • 请求示例:
    <?xml version="1.0" encoding="UTF-8"?> 
    <pwd> 
         <dictionaryName/> 
    </pwd>
  • 响应示例(XML格式):
    <?xml version="1.0" encoding="UTF-8"?> 
    <pwd> 
        <dictionaryName>flash:/</dictionaryName> 
    </pwd>

    响应元素说明如表10-12所示。

    表10-12 响应元素说明

    元素

    描述

    dictionaryName

    用户当前工作目录。

    响应状态码说明如表10-13所示。

    表10-13 响应状态码说明

    状态码

    描述

    200 OK

    操作执行成功。

    400 Bad Request

    无法执行请求操作,请求消息语法错误,或者请求消息中信息的属性不合法。

    500 Internal Server Error

    服务的各种内部异常导致请求操作失败,或者无法识别的处理异常。

显示文件或目录信息

操作

URI

描述

GET

/vfm/dirs/dir

获取指定文件或目录的信息。

  • 请求示例:
    <?xml version="1.0" encoding="UTF-8"?> 
    <dir> 
        <dirName>cfcard:/</dirName>
        <fileName>VRPV8.cc</fileName> 
    </dir>

    请求中元素说明如表10-14所示。

    表10-14 请求中元素说明

    元素

    描述

    dirName

    待显示的文件或目录所在的目录,非必选参数,无此参数时,默认为当前目录。

    fileName

    待显示的文件或目录名称,必选参数。

  • 响应示例(XML格式):
    <?xml version="1.0" encoding="UTF-8"?> 
    <dir> 
        <dirName>cfcard:/</dirName>
        <Attr>-rwx</Attr> 
        <DirSize>183,329,667</DirSize> 
        <modifyDatetime>2013-08-17T21:03:22</modifyDatetime> 
        <fileName>VRPV8.cc</fileName>
        <intDirSize>183329667</intDirSize>
    </dir>
    响应元素说明如表10-15所示。
    表10-15 响应元素说明

    元素

    描述

    dirName

    目录名称。

    Attr

    文件或目录的权限。

    DirSize

    文件或目录大小。

    modifyDatetime

    文件或目录的修改时间。

    fileName

    文件或目录名称。

    intDirSzie

    文件或目录大小(整数形式)。

    响应状态码说明如表10-16所示。

    表10-16 响应状态码说明

    状态码

    描述

    200 OK

    操作执行成功。

    400 Bad Request

    无法执行请求操作,请求消息语法错误,或者请求消息中信息的属性不合法。

    500 Internal Server Error

    服务的各种内部异常导致请求操作失败,或者无法识别的处理异常。

获取磁盘空间利用率信息

操作

URI

描述

GET

/vfm/dfs

获取磁盘空间利用率信息。

  • 请求示例:
    <?xml version="1.0" encoding="UTF-8"?> 
    <dfs> 
        <df> 
           <fileSys>flash</fileSys> 
           <inputPath>flash</inputPath> 
        </df> 
    </dfs>

    请求中元素说明如表10-17所示。

    表10-17 请求中元素说明

    元素

    描述

    fileSys

    分区名称,文件系统分区名称。

    inputPath

    分区路径,文件系统分区所在的路径。

  • 响应示例(XML格式):
    <?xml version="1.0" encoding="UTF-8"?> 
    <dfs> 
        <df> 
           <fileSys>lash</fileSys> 
           <inputPath>flash</inputPath> 
           <totalSize>291991552</totalSize> 
           <freeSize>86472156</freeSize> 
           <usedPer>70</usedPer> 
        </df> 
    <dfs>

    响应元素说明如表10-18所示。

    表10-18 响应元素说明

    元素

    描述

    fileSys

    文件系统分区名称。

    inputPath

    文件系统分区所在的路径。

    totalSize

    文件系统分区的总大小(KB)。

    freeSize

    文件系统分区的空闲大小(KB)。

    usedPer

    文件系统分区已使用百分比(%)。

    响应状态码说明如表10-19所示。

    表10-19 响应状态码说明

    状态码

    描述

    200 OK

    操作执行成功。

    400 Bad Request

    无法执行请求操作,请求消息语法错误,或者请求消息中信息的属性不合法。

    500 Internal Server Error

    服务的各种内部异常导致请求操作失败,或者无法识别的处理异常。

复制文件

操作

URI

描述

POST

/vfm/copyFile

复制文件。

  • 请求示例:
    <?xml version="1.0" encoding="UTF-8"?> 
    <copyFile> 
        <srcFileName>flash:/VRPV8.cc</srcFileName> 
        <desFileName>slave#flash:/VRPV8.cc</desFileName> 
    </copyFile>

    请求中元素说明如表10-20所示。

    表10-20 请求中元素说明

    元素

    描述

    srcFileName

    拷贝的源文件名称,必选参数。

    desFileName

    拷贝的目标文件名称,必选参数。

  • 响应示例(XML格式):
    <?xml version="1.0" encoding="UTF-8"?> 
    <ok/>

    响应状态码说明如表10-21所示。

    表10-21 响应状态码说明

    状态码

    描述

    200 OK

    操作执行成功。

    400 Bad Request

    无法执行请求操作,请求消息语法错误,或者请求消息中信息的属性不合法。

    500 Internal Server Error

    服务的各种内部异常导致请求操作失败,或者无法识别的处理异常。

删除文件

操作

URI

描述

POST

/vfm/deleteFileUnRes

永久删除文件。

  • 请求示例:
    <?xml version="1.0" encoding="UTF-8"?> 
    <deleteFileUnRes> 
        <fileName>slave#flash:/VRPV8.cc</fileName> 
    </deleteFileUnRes>

    请求中元素说明如表10-22所示。

    表10-22 请求中元素说明

    元素

    描述

    fileName

    待删除的文件路径名称,必选参数。

  • 响应示例(XML格式):
    <?xml version="1.0" encoding="UTF-8"?> 
    <ok/>

    响应状态码说明如表10-23所示。

    表10-23 响应状态码说明

    状态码

    描述

    200 OK

    操作执行成功。

    400 Bad Request

    无法执行请求操作,请求消息语法错误,或者请求消息中信息的属性不合法。

    500 Internal Server Error

    服务的各种内部异常导致请求操作失败,或者无法识别的处理异常。

压缩文件

操作

URI

描述

POST

/vfm/zipFile

压缩文件。

  • 请求示例:
    <?xml version="1.0" encoding="UTF-8"?> 
    <zipFile> 
        <srcFileName>src.txt</srcFileName>
        <desFileName>des.zip</desFileName>
        <password>123456789a</password>
        <overwriteType>yes</overwriteType> 
    </zipFile>

    请求中元素说明如表10-24所示。

    表10-24 请求中元素说明

    元素

    描述

    srcFileName

    指定被压缩的源文件名称,支持全路径或相对路径。

    desFileName

    指定压缩后的目标文件名称,支持全路径或相对路径。

    password

    指定加密压缩文件密码,由英文字母、数字和特殊字符组成,不支持中文。

    overwriteType

    是否覆盖与目的文件同名的文件。

  • 响应示例(XML格式):
    <?xml version="1.0" encoding="UTF-8"?> 
    <ok/>

    响应状态码说明如表10-25所示。

    表10-25 响应状态码说明

    状态码

    描述

    200 OK

    操作执行成功。

    400 Bad Request

    无法执行请求操作,请求消息语法错误,或者请求消息中信息的属性不合法。

    500 Internal Server Error

    服务的各种内部异常导致请求操作失败,或者无法识别的处理异常。

解压文件

操作

URI

描述

POST

/vfm/unzipFile

解压缩文件。

  • 请求示例:
    <?xml version="1.0" encoding="UTF-8"?> 
    <unzipFile> 
        <srcFileName>src.zip</srcFileName>
        <desFileName>des.txt</desFileName>
        <password>123456789a</password>
        <overwriteType>yes</overwriteType> 
    </unzipFile>

    请求中元素说明如表10-26所示。

    表10-26 请求中元素说明

    元素

    描述

    srcFileName

    指定解压缩的源文件名称,支持全路径或相对路径。

    desFileName

    指定解压缩后的目标文件名称,支持全路径或相对路径。

    password

    指定解压缩加密文件的校验密码,由英文字母、数字和特殊字符组成,不支持中文。

    overwriteType

    是否覆盖与目的文件同名的文件。

  • 响应示例(XML格式):
    <?xml version="1.0" encoding="UTF-8"?> 
    <ok/>

    响应状态码说明如表10-27所示。

    表10-27 响应状态码说明

    状态码

    描述

    200 OK

    操作执行成功。

    400 Bad Request

    无法执行请求操作,请求消息语法错误,或者请求消息中信息的属性不合法。

    500 Internal Server Error

    服务的各种内部异常导致请求操作失败,或者无法识别的处理异常。

翻译
下载文档
更新时间:2019-04-03

文档编号:EDOC1100075559

浏览量:2542

下载量:44

平均得分:
本文档适用于这些产品
相关文档
相关版本
分享
上一页 下一页